Discover the breathtaking beauty of Lithuania’s Curonian Spit on this guided canoe tour departing from Klaipeda. This UNESCO World Heritage site is a narrow stretch of land shaped by wind, water, and sand, offering an unforgettable escape into nature and culture.
Your adventure begins with a scenic ferry ride from Klaipeda to the charming village of Pervalka, passing through the quiet embankments of Juodkrante. Along the way, you’ll witness the dramatic migrating dunes and admire the unique landscapes that make this destination so special.
After a safety briefing, embark on your cedar canoe journey along the Curonian Lagoon. Paddle towards the iconic Pervalka Lighthouse, taking in panoramic dune views and the tranquil waters. There is time to pause for photos and soak in the serene atmosphere around this historic landmark.
As the tour continues, you’ll relax with a coffee or tea while gazing at the spectacular dunes. On the return, stop at one of Europe’s largest heron and cormorant colonies, followed by a visit to the picturesque village of Juodkrante. The tour includes your ferry transfer, canoe equipment, and refreshments, but meals are not included.
